OK, for some specifics as to your questions:

1. While I don't exactly what it is you desire to do as stated, I will say that to make sure each page is identical to begin with just set up one page to look as you desire, select that page in the left hand column and use "Duplicate" under the "Edit" menu to establish new pages as desired with the same exact layout. Then you can make particular color changes etc on the individual pages.

2. As far as removing the browser background altogether, I would imagine the best way is to just set it to white in the Browser Background section of the Page inspector (below).

3. I don't use any of the default layouts myself- I just start with the "Blank" page in any of the layout themes (usually starting with the Black or White theme) and lay out elements as desired on the page with text blocks, images, etc.
